Abstract

Disclosed herein is a panel system for covering a building wall. The panel system includes at least one panel assembly. Each panel assembly includes a panel having a front panel wall, a side panel wall, and a back mounting flange overhanging the front panel wall. Each panel also includes at least one perimeter extrusion. Each perimeter extrusion includes a panel engaging portion having a panel slot shaped to receive the back mounting flange of the panel, and a connector engaging portion having a connector slot. The panel system also includes at least one connector extrusion for mounting the panel assembly to the building wall. Each connector extrusion includes a connector base mountable to the building wall, and at least one connector flange shaped to fit in the connector slot of the perimeter extrusion.

Claims (31)

1. A building panel mounted to a building wall, the building panel comprising:

a front panel wall;

a plurality of side panel walls extending along a perimeter of the front panel wall; and

a plurality of back mounting flanges,

each back mounting flange extending from a respective side panel wall of the plurality of side panel walls,

each back mounting flange overhanging the front panel wall,

each back mounting flange extending in length from a first flange end to a second flange end,

the plurality of back mounting flanges including at least a first back mounting flange and a second back mounting flange, and

the first flange end of the first back mounting flange including a flange protrusion received in a flange recess of the second flange end of the second back mounting flange.

2. The building panel of claim 1 , wherein each side panel wall extends orthogonally to the front panel wall.

3. The building panel of claim 1 , wherein each back mounting flange extends orthogonally to the respective side panel wall.

4. The building panel of claim 1 , wherein each flange end of each back mounting flange is adjacent the first or second flange end of another of said back mounting flanges forming an adjacent pair of flange ends.

5. The building panel of claim 4 , wherein in each adjacent pair of flange ends, a flange protrusion of one flange end is received in a flange recess of another flange end.

6. The building panel of claim 1 , wherein the flange protrusion is shaped to mate with the flange recess.

7. The building panel of claim 1 , wherein a shape of the flange recess is the negative of a shape of the flange protrusion.

8. A method of forming a panel, the method comprising:

providing a flat panel blank having a front panel wall and a plurality of peripheral panel portions extending along a periphery of the panel blank,

the front panel wall and the peripheral panel portions being coplanar,

each peripheral panel portion including a side panel wall inboard of a back mounting flange,

each back mounting flange extending in length from a first flange end to a second flange end,

each of the first and second flange ends of each back mounting flange including at least one of a flange protrusion and a flange recess;

for each peripheral panel portion, folding the back mounting flange relative to the side panel wall, and folding the side panel wall relative to the front panel wall to form a U-shaped channel; and

engaging the flange protrusions and flange recesses of adjacent flange ends of adjacent back mounting flanges.

9. The method of claim 8 , further comprising:

for each peripheral panel portion, forming a first fold line between the side panel wall and the front panel wall.

10. The method of claim 9 , wherein:

said folding the side panel wall relative to the front panel wall comprises folding the side panel wall along the first fold line.

11. The method of claim 8 , further comprising:

for each peripheral panel portion, forming a second fold line between the side panel wall and the back mounting flange.

12. The method of claim 11 , wherein:

said folding the back mounting flange relative to the side panel wall comprises folding the back mounting flange along the second fold line.
